One of the most common problems that can occur with uPVC windows is that they become difficult to open or lock. This usually happens when the locking mechanism is stiff or jammed. If this is the case, an easy solution is to utilize graphite powder or machine oil to make sure that the lock's handle is lubricated and the lock mechanism. This will let the mechanism free up and the door or window to function normal again.
Another issue that often arises with uPVC windows is that the hinges become stiff or stuck. This is usually caused by grit and dust that build up on the hinges over time. Lubricating the hinges using grease or oil is the solution. Using the wrong type of grease, however, could cause damage and make the hinges unusable.

Repairs to stained glass
Stained glass windows are gorgeous elements in churches, homes and other buildings. They can add visual interest, privacy and light an area. They can be fragile and require constant care to ensure they are in good condition. Even with the best care, stained and lead glass windows can deteriorate over time due to age and exposure to weather and other environmental factors. This can cause cracks, fading, and water leakage. It is crucial to find a local expert to restore your stained or stained window to its original beauty.
On average, the cost of repair of broken or cracked stained glass is approximately $500. The exact cost will depend on the type of solution needed to fix the issue. A professional might employ epoxy edge-gluing or copper foil to repair the broken glass. They can also relead lead and seal stained glass. Several options are available and each comes with advantages and disadvantages. The best option is determined by the size, location and type of glass used.
Cracks in leaded glass can be caused by thermal expansion and contraction, building movement, or simply normal wear and tear. The cracks can enlarge and cause more problems as time passes. To avoid further damage and expansion the crack that is located across an important part of stained-glass panels or the face must be repaired as soon as possible. In the past, this was typically done by splicing the "Dutchman" lead flange on top of the crack. This was not a good solution, and now there are better ways to repair these types of cracks.
Stained glass restoration is a highly skilled art that can come in many forms. It can be as easy as fixing cracks, or as complex as restoring an entire stained glass window or door panel to its original state. Generally speaking, the cost of restoration projects is much more than that of an easy repair or replacement. The job involves cleaning and taking out damaged glass, tightening lead cames, sealing the cement and re-tying it and reinstalling stained glass pieces that are missing.
Weatherstripping Repairs
Weatherstripping stops water and UPVC Window Repairs Near Me air from entering homes through the gaps around windows and doors. It is an essential element of home maintenance that can save you money on costs for energy and repairs that are costly. It can also make a home more comfortable. The materials used to make this seal will degrade with time, due to wear and tears. It is important to replace these materials periodically.
You can tell if your weather stripping has worn out by noticing a spot that is wet after washing your windows, a whistling noise when driving down the road, or a draft that you feel when you are in front of the door that is closed. These are all good indicators to locate a Tasker in my area who can provide weatherstripping repair.
Taskers can employ various weatherstripping products to seal your doors and windows. Foam tapes can be made from closed cell or open-cell foam. They are available in a variety of sizes, thicknesses, and widths. They are simple to install and can be cut by cutting. Felt strips are inexpensive and last for a year or more. You can cut them into lengths using scissors and attach them to the frame of your door or hinge side of the sliding windows with staples, glue, or tacks. Metal or vinyl V-strips are somewhat more difficult to install however they can be secured with nails into the window jamb.
